什么是跨域,跨域是指不同域之间相互访问,只要协议、域名、端口有任何一个不同,都被当作是不同的域。 对于端口和协议的不同,只能通过后台来解决,前台是无能为力的。 受浏览器同源策略的限制,本域的js不能操作其他域的页面对象(比如DOM)。同源策略(Same origin policy)是一种约定,它是浏 ...
分类:
Web程序 时间:
2016-12-06 02:16:37
阅读次数:
269
我们在配置一台服务器的时候,如果只运行一个站点,往往过于浪费资源。Nginx和Apache都可以通过配置虚拟主机实现多站点。配置虚拟主机的方式主要有两种,一种是多个不同端口对应的多个虚拟主机站点,一种是同一端口对应多个不同域名的虚拟主机站点。这里我用80端口为例,在apache配置多个不同域名虚拟主 ...
分类:
Web程序 时间:
2016-12-05 23:32:47
阅读次数:
309
首先我们得了解什么是跨域 我们来回顾一下一个域名地址的组成: http:// www abc.com :8080 /script/jquery.js 协议 子域名 主域名 端口号 请求资源地址 当协议、子域名、主域名、端口号不同时,都算作不同域 不同域之间相互请求资源,就算做“跨域” 比如:http ...
分类:
编程语言 时间:
2016-11-30 11:36:57
阅读次数:
140
这里说的js跨域是指通过js在不同的域之间进行数据传输或通信,比如用ajax向一个不同的域请求数据,或者通过js获取页面中不同域的框架中(iframe)的数据。只要协议、域名、端口有任何一个不同,都被...
分类:
Web程序 时间:
2016-11-16 15:40:03
阅读次数:
245
什么是跨域: 这里说的js跨域是指通过js在不同的域之间进行数据传输或通信,比如用ajax向一个不同的域请求数据,或者通过js获取页面中不同域的框架中(iframe)的数据。只要协议、域名、端口有任何一个不同,都被当作是不同的域。 一、通过jsonp跨域 首先在客户端注册一个callback (如: ...
分类:
其他好文 时间:
2016-11-16 13:37:04
阅读次数:
142
原文http://www.cnblogs.com/2050/p/3191744.html 这里说的js跨域是指通过js在不同的域之间进行数据传输或通信,比如用ajax向一个不同的域请求数据,或者通过js获取页面中不同域的框架中(iframe)的数据。 只要协议、域名、端口有任何一个不同,都被当作是不 ...
分类:
Web程序 时间:
2016-11-09 11:43:31
阅读次数:
224
转自:js中几种实用的跨域方法原理详解 - 无双 - 博客园 这里说的js跨域是指通过js在不同的域之间进行数据传输或通信,比如用ajax向一个不同的域请求数据,或者通过js获取页面中不同域的框架中(iframe)的数据。只要协议、域名、端口有任何一个不同,都被当作是不同的域。 下表给出了相对htt ...
分类:
Web程序 时间:
2016-11-06 11:21:28
阅读次数:
301
虚拟目录标识方式:不同IP不同端口不同域名#2.2版本之前的需要注释掉中心主机DocumentRoot,不然会引起冲突虚拟主机案例1.基于不同IP的虚拟主机NameVirtualHost192.168.88.1<Virtualhost192.168.88.1>ServerNamewww.luyubo1.comDocumentRoot"/home/httpd/luyubo1"<Dir..
分类:
Web程序 时间:
2016-11-03 03:00:06
阅读次数:
536
需要添加多域名,或者不同域名在不通端口下访问需要在tomcat/conf/server.xml文件下,在server标签下添加<Servicename="OPEPC">
<Connectorport="80"prot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443"/>
<Connectorport="8010"protocol="AJ..
分类:
其他好文 时间:
2016-10-26 17:01:00
阅读次数:
155
做双十一,需要在主会场页面,嵌入我们产品的JS豆腐块。而这个豆腐块需要调用我们后端的数据接口,涉及跨域访问。 参考 http://www.cnblogs.com/2050/p/3191744.html 方案1: 在js中,我们虽然不能直接用XMLHttpRequest请求不同域上的数据时,但是在页面 ...
分类:
Web程序 时间:
2016-10-26 00:25:18
阅读次数:
176